It was a jolly good time Saturday at John's Crazy Socks as John and Mark Cronin celebrated seven years in business with a holiday pop-up shop at their Farmingdale headquarters.
The father-son duo started the world's largest sock store on Long Island.
More than half of the company's employees have developmental disabilities.
John's Crazy Socks is hosting a special "12 Days of Giving" sale for the holidays so that shoppers can stock up on socks for their loved ones.
A portion of all of the proceeds will go to charity.
